BTQ chief quantum officer co-authors quantum error correction research

April 16, 2026 7:31 AM

BTQ Technologies Corp. (NASDAQ: BTQ) announced that Chief Quantum Officer Dr. Gavin K. Brennen co-authored research introducing a general theory of quantum error correction for permutation-invariant codes. The work was conducted in collaboration with Macquarie University and researcher Yingkai Ouyang from the University of Sheffield.

The paper, titled "A theory of quantum error correction for permutation-invariant codes," presents what the authors describe as the first general theory of error correction for permutation-invariant codes. The research introduces algorithms designed to correct errors on permutation-invariant codes and presents a simplified approach for certain erasure and deletion errors.

Permutation-invariant codes represent a category of quantum error correction methods that differ from more commonly studied stabilizer codes. According to the research, these codes can correct standard errors as well as errors that other codes cannot address, while remaining simpler to control in certain architectures.

The research addresses quantum error correction, which is considered essential for reliable quantum systems as they scale. BTQ operates quantum software platform QPerfect, which includes QLU for fault-tolerant quantum control and MIMIQ for quantum emulation.

BTQ Technologies is a Vancouver-based quantum technology company that develops quantum and post-quantum security solutions across multiple industries including finance, telecommunications, and defense. The company trades on both NASDAQ and CBOE Canada under the ticker BTQ.
